Output cca63e7382b62ad86a1f358a405022c56e58e038ee9be2171fd800134f434a6f:1

value
4582857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1dec9287633da3dbef1d7c3bcdfcff0be635036 OP_EQUAL
address
3KN7DzbuJXrBxrSLbEv36YuNY6trFjtPTC
transaction
cca63e7382b62ad86a1f358a405022c56e58e038ee9be2171fd800134f434a6f
confirmations
277785
spent
true